Abstract

In this paper, we successfully solve some linear Δ−fractional dynamic equations (Δ−FDE) with Caputo Δ−derivative analytically by solving an auxiliary linear Δ−differential equation (Δ−DE) with an integer order. The idea of the proposed method is based on transforming the given Δ−FDE into a linear Δ−DE with an integer order. This transformation removes certain terms of the solution of the considered Δ−FDE, resulting in the remaining terms being a solution to the auxiliary equation. To demonstrate the ability and efficacy of this idea, several examples have been provided.
